Durability and Longevity



When it concerns sturdiness and longevity, the choice in between asphalt tiles and metal roof can considerably influence the lifespan of your roof covering. Steel roof covering has a tendency to have a much longer lifespan compared to asphalt tiles. Steel roofings can last 40-70 years or even more, while asphalt tiles commonly last around 20-30 years. Steel roof is recognized for its resistance to extreme weather such as hefty rainfall, snow, hail, and high winds. Furthermore, metal roofings are fireproof and do not rot or establish mold, making them a durable choice for your home.

On the other hand, asphalt roof shingles are a lot more prone to damage from severe climate, which can result in the need for more constant repair work or substitutes.


While asphalt tiles are at first extra budget-friendly than steel roof covering, the lasting expenses of upkeep and substitutes can build up. Consequently, if resilience and longevity are your top concerns, purchasing a steel roof might be a much more affordable choice over time.

Cost and Upkeep



In thinking about cost and maintenance, the financial aspects of choosing between asphalt shingles and steel roof play a crucial role in your decision-making process.

Asphalt roof shingles are usually more cost effective upfront, making them a preferred option for budget-conscious house owners. Nonetheless, it's vital to factor in lasting upkeep costs. Asphalt tiles might call for even more constant repair work and substitutes because of deterioration from weather.

On the other hand, while metal roof has a greater preliminary price, it's recognized for its longevity and long life, requiring minimal upkeep over its lifespan. This might result in price financial savings in the long run as you won't have to bother with routinely changing your roofing system. In addition, metal roofs are often much more energy-efficient, bring about potential financial savings on heating & cooling bills.

Prior to making a decision, consider your budget plan not just for the installation but likewise for the upkeep of your roof covering in the years ahead.
